Throwing objects is one of the most common actions people perform in their daily lives. But the term "throwing" can get a little stale if used too much. Luckily, there are plenty of synonyms for the word "throw" that can add some variety to your vocabulary. Some common synonyms include toss, hurl, fling, pitch, lob, and heave. More specific synonyms include cast, propel, chuck, launch, and sling. Each of these synonyms can be used in different contexts, so choose the one that best suits your writing or speaking style. Regardless of which word you choose, however, each of these synonyms provides a more dynamic and engaging alternative to the word "throw".

How to use "Throw" in context?

Throw is a verb meaning to cause (something) to be sent or projected with a quick motion or vibration. It is chiefly used with objects that are heavy, such as a rock, a baseball, or a piece of furniture. To throw something is to cause it to leave one's hand or body suddenly and fall to the ground.
